Uploaded image for project: 'Red Hat OpenShift Dev Spaces (formerly CodeReady Workspaces) '
  1. Red Hat OpenShift Dev Spaces (formerly CodeReady Workspaces)
  2. CRW-344

Use npm cache/mirror for all jobs in Central CI

XMLWordPrintable

    • Icon: Task Task
    • Resolution: Obsolete
    • Icon: Major Major
    • 3.7.0.GA
    • 1.2.1.GA
    • testing
    • None
    • QE-2019-09-03 (Sprint: 171), QE-2019-09-24 (Sprint: 172)

      Quote of mail, that went to prod-dept mailing list:

      Hi All,
      Sorry for casting such a wide net, however time is of the essence. Currently we are potentially at risk with upstream, node.js / npm registry. There is excess traffic from Red Hat, we are potentially violating our terms of use. They have reached out to us and asked us to take action. To help limit the amount of traffic.
      
      This issues is already being worked on at several levels inside of Red Hat. This email is not to explore any more solutions at this time. This email is a request to Red Hat engineering to use our internal local registry / cache [1] for getting npm dependencies.
      
      *Disclosure I am not a node.js / npm expert. Some specific details on what is needed in your specific configurations to ensure you are using the internal registry I may not have, but I will help where I can.  If you have questions please reach out to me (off-list) preference would email or google chat. 
      
      [1] https://repository.engineering.redhat.com/nexus/repository/registry.npmjs.org
      
      Thank you in advance,
      Jeff
      

      We should make sure all our (npm based) jobs are using our internal npm package mirror.

              rhopp@redhat.com Radim Hopp
              rhopp@redhat.com Radim Hopp
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

                Created:
                Updated:
                Resolved: